题解列表

筛选

优质题解

不容易系列 递归求解

摘要:解题思路:本人在写时,发现可以用递归来写。什么是递归:(忙人请略过)程序调用自身的编程技巧称为递归。递归做为一种算法在程序设计语言中广泛应用。递归,就是在运行的过程中调用自己。 一个过程或函数在其定义……

c++ 快速排序练习一下

摘要:解题思路:使用快速排序完成数组的排序,虽然比较复杂一点,而且对于这个有顺序的序列显然效果是最不好的,只是练习一下。注意事项:参考代码:#include<iostream>using namespace……

1011: [编程入门]最大公约数与最小公倍数

摘要:解题思路: 注意最大公约数 和最小公倍数的算法 最大公约数 若A与B 可以整除 则大的数为最小公倍数,小的数为最大公约数;若A与B不能整除 则将B的值赋予A 将A%B的值赋予B 再次循环A%B的运算 ……

按部就班的求解思路

摘要:解题思路:注意到每次相加的数会多一位2,那就相当于前一个数乘以10之后在个位加上一个2;例如:22,是2*10+2;那么只需要将k置为2,每次循环时*10,再加上2,就得到了下一次需要加上的数;和su……

1010: [编程入门]利润计算

摘要:解题思路: 中学的应用题,很明显的分段函数(选择结构)注意事项: 有6个区间 要注意区间划分 每个区间函数不同 要顺清思路 参考代码:#include<stdio.h>int main(){     ……

1008: [编程入门]成绩评定

摘要:解题思路:选择结构注意事项:划分区间 注意 能否取等参考代码:#include<stdio.h>int main(){    int a;    scanf("%d",&a);    if(a>=90……

[编程入门]字符串分类统计

摘要:解题思路:注意事项:注意:字母分为大小写。所以有两个范围。参考代码:#include<stdio.h> int main() {     int a=0,b=0,c=0,d=0,ch;    ……

[编程入门]最大公约数与最小公倍数(使用for循环解决)

摘要:解题思路:最大公约数一定小于或等于输入的两数中的更小数(当然肯定小于输入数字的更大数),最小公倍数一定大于或等于输入两数中的更大数。所以先找出大的那个数,然后用for循环依次查找,找到后用break语……

数字的处理与判断

摘要:解题思路:求位数 用循环递减                空格分开 递归每次去掉最高位                逆序 递归输出最后位 然后除最后位注意事项:工具箱参考代码:#include<s……